DIY Saturday | Crayon Wall Art ♥

Happy Saturday!
Today I'll be writing instructions to make this simple, artistic Crayon Wall Art!
It looks complex, but in reality - it's actually simplistic! 

You will need:
  • A canvas
This can be any size, depending on how many crayons you plan on using and really what size you want!
  • A pack of crayons!
I've only seen this DIY done with Crayola crayons, so whether or not this will work with other crayons, I don't know.
  • A hair dryer
This is what you will use to make the melted effect!
  • A glue gun, or a type of super strong glue

Step 1
Aline the crayons in what order you would like them to be in, you can color co-ordinate, use only a couple of crayons, whatever you like, I recommend the rainbow because I just think it looks super adorable!

Step 2
Using a glue gun, or a really strong type of glue, stick the crayons to the top of the canvas and wait for it to dry.

Step 3
Using a hairdryer, hold it over the crayons for a couple of minutes, allowing the crayon to melt and run down the canvas

This shouldn't take to long to dry, but when it's done, the canvas is done!

In this post, I'm going to talk a little about storage for beginners, as you hardly want to be splashing out big bucks on massive storage draws when you haven't got enough make-up yet and could make some out of cardboard and paint that will be pretty enough, and more efficient.
You can find loads of DIYS on make-up storage on youtube and online forums. You can also make your own out of cardboard, paint, sellotape and maybe some pretty ribbon.
There is also in-expensive sites and stores (eg. $/£ stores) that sell drawers or containers that could be handy and a temporary solution.

By having separate compartments within your storage methods, whether it be a drawer, a home-made storage box, a container, you can section out your make-up into categories.

For example:

  • Face
  • Eyes
  • Lips
In face, you would have your foundation, concealer, powder and blushes
In eyes, you would have your shadows, eyebrow shadows, eyeliners and mascaras
Then in lips, you would have your lip balms, lip gloss, and lipsticks

This organizes your make-up, so when you have your bigger collection, you don't have a pile of un-organised mess to sort out, so keep it organised from the beginning and it won't be such a chore when it gets bigger.
